Sinopsis

In its fourth edition, this dictionary contains 9000 entries on all aspects of science. Suitable for both students and non-scientists, it provides coverage of biology (including human biology), chemistry, physics, the earth sciences, and astronomy; short biographies of leading scientists; full-page illustration features on such subjects as El Nino, the Solar System, and Genetically Modified Organisms; and chronologies of specific scientific subjects, including plastics, electronics, and cell biology.
